Fix assertion with relation using REPLICA IDENTITY FULL in subscriber
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
In a logical replication subscriber, a table using REPLICA IDENTITY FULL
which has a primary key would try to use the primary key's index
available to scan for a tuple, but an assertion only assumed as correct
the case of an index associated to REPLICA IDENTITY USING INDEX.  This
commit corrects the assertion so as the use of a primary key index is a
valid case.
